What Is Dry Needling?
Dry needling involves inserting a thin, sterile needle directly into a tight or irritated muscle, often called a trigger point. Unlike acupuncture, dry needling is rooted in Western medicine and targets specific muscles tied to your pain or movement limitations. The goal is to release tension, reduce pain, and improve how the muscle functions.
It’s typically used as one part of a broader physical therapy plan rather than a standalone treatment.
Who Benefits From Dry Needling Therapy?
Dry needling therapy can help people dealing with:
- Muscle tightness or trigger points limiting movement
- Back, neck, or shoulder pain
- Hip, knee, ankle, or foot muscle pain
- Sports injuries affecting muscle function
- Chronic muscle tension that hasn’t responded to other treatment
If you’ve tried stretching or general exercise without relief, dry needling may address muscle restrictions that are harder to reach with those methods alone.
